Diwali lights up Shepparton with celebration of survival

DiwaliDiwali – sometimes called Deepavali – is a festival of light. It is a joyful time, a happy family time – observed by Hindus, Jains, Sikhs, and in some places, Buddhists. There is a legend that Diwali commemorates the time Lord Krishna saved the earth from an incoming meteorite by raising his hand into the sky and making the meteorite explode.

